基于图像识别在线推断烧结矿产量的研究
Study of On-line Inference Sintering Production Based on Image Recognition
【摘要】 运用数字图像处理技术 ,对烧结机尾的断面图像进行了处理和分析 ,并结合工艺研究成果、专家经验和常规仪表数据 ,解决烧结矿产量的在线推断问题 .安阳钢铁公司烧结厂的现场实验结果表明 ,通过适当的图像模糊增强 ,采用Marr -Heldreth算法着重对烧成带、燃烧带和生料层进行边缘检测等处理 ,系统达到了接近于 1级的预测精度 .该方法还可用于解决烧结终点的闭环控制 ,以及与纹理和颜色相关的质量指标的预报 .
【Abstract】 This paper applies digital image processing technique to analyze and process sinter image.Meanwhile,according to the expert’s experience and traditional instrument data,its aim consists in solving the problem of on-line deducing sinter production.With the processing of moderate image fuzzy enhancement,this paper uses Marr-Heldreth algorithm to detect the edges of combustion zone,the buming zone and raw layer etc.The result of Anyang Iron & Steel Company’s experiments indicates that this system has been up to and close to 1-grade predicting precision.Moreover,this research may be used to solve sintering terminal loop control and predict quality indicatrix relating to color and grain.
【Key words】 image processing; sintering; fuzzy enhancement; edge detection;
